The Royal Crest is a symbol found in many The Legend of Zelda games. This crest can be found on all sorts of equipment such as swords, shields, instruments, blocks, walls and on ceremonial or royal clothing. In Ocarina of Time, Link can play the Ocarina to open passageways or prove a connection to the Royal Family of Hyrule. The main feature of the crest is the Triforce in the center, while the bottom part of the crest is in the shape of a bird, depicting the Loftwings flown by the citizens of Skyloft, who are descendants of the Hylians.
